US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"if they emphasize"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when discussing the importance or focus that someone places on a particular point or idea. Example: "The effectiveness of the presentation will depend on if they emphasize the key findings clearly."

Linguistic Context

The phrase "if they emphasize" functions as a conditional clause, introducing a condition based on the act of emphasizing something. It sets up a scenario where the outcome depends on what "they" choose to highlight or give importance to. As evidenced by Ludwig's examples, this phrase is used to indicate the dependence of a result on a specific focus or prioritization.

FAQs

How can I use "if they emphasize" in a sentence?

You can use "if they emphasize" to introduce a conditional statement about highlighting particular aspects. For example, "The project will succeed if they emphasize teamwork and communication."

What are some alternatives to "if they emphasize"?

Alternatives include "if they highlight", "if they stress", or "should they underscore", depending on the nuance you wish to convey.

Is it more formal to use "if they emphasize" or "if they stress"?

"If they emphasize" is generally considered more formal than "if they stress", although both are acceptable in most contexts. The choice depends on the overall tone and audience of your writing.

How does "if they emphasize" differ from "if they mention"?

"If they emphasize" implies a deliberate focus and highlighting of particular information, while "if they mention" simply suggests that something is brought up without necessarily being a focal point.
